Default Low Arctic temperatures

Only about thirty years of looking - but I cannot recall seeing
temperatures so low for March over the Arctic side of Canada. On the
00z 3rd March plotted chart I can see two MS48's and a MS44 over
Elsemere? Islands to the north of Baffin Island also of note is the
MS53 over western Siberia.
